Abstract(in English) The purpose of this paper is Examination of influence on GDOP when abeyance satellite of GPS or Quasi Zenithal Satellite System(QZSS). GPS is operated by 28. Sometimes, positioning-service of one satellite is stopped for maintenance. QZSS will be similarly generated. Visible for one in the satellite time of QZSS is longer than that of GPS. Therefore, QZSS is thought that the influences are larger than GPS. Examination of influence on GDOP when abeyance satellite of GPS or QZSS is examined in this paper..
